After I finished the install I noticed that my Air Bag light is on now!

I have no idea what I did to cause this.
The only thing I can think of is, when installing the amp I tried to remove the passenger seat. I was going for a stealth install look by hiding the amp under the seat.

I tried to disconnect the yellow cables, but couldn't so I just worked around them.

After talking to my brother he told me anything in yellow is usally related to the SRS system.

Does anyone know how to get that light to turn off?
My car has never been any type of accident so its not a real air bag code.

pricha00
06-26-2010, 07:28 PM
From what I have been told their is some sort of defect that causes an intermittent problem where the SRS computer detects some sort of problem with the drivers latch. The latch always worked well, it is a electrical issue inside the latch. After reset it would take a few days or maybe a week or so to come back on. I believe in the US Honda was doing this fix under an TBS but up here I had to fight to get at least some coverage for this repair. I got Honda to pay for the part and I paid a dealer to install it. The part is not inexpensive!!!!
